Hi
Running the following Ex command causes an internal error
in Vim-8.0.123 and older:
:call assert_inrange(1, 1)
E685: Internal error: get_tv_number(UNKNOWN)
Function assert_inrange() should have 3 or 4 arguments,
but passing 2 arguments should not cause an internal error.
Bug was found
Patch 8.0.0122
Problem:Channel test is still flaky on OS X.
Solution: Add a short sleep.
Files: src/testdir/test_channel.py
*** ../vim-8.0.0121/src/testdir/test_channel.py 2016-08-26 17:22:37.0
+0200
--- src/testdir/test_channel.py 2016-12-03 15:22:24.811533565 +0100
Patch 8.0.0121
Problem:Setting 'cursorline' changes the curswant column. (Daniel Hahler)
Solution: Add the P_RWINONLY flag. (closes #1297)
Files: src/option.c, src/testdir/test_goto.vim
*** ../vim-8.0.0120/src/option.c2016-11-29 22:10:44.221151470 +0100
--- src/option.c
Patch 8.0.0123
Problem:Modern Sun compilers define "__sun" instead of "sun".
Solution: Use __sun. (closes #1296)
Files: src/mbyte.c, src/pty.c, src/os_unixx.h, src/vim.h
*** ../vim-8.0.0122/src/mbyte.c 2016-08-29 22:42:20.0 +0200
--- src/mbyte.c 2016-12-03 16:28:33.069347623
Patch 8.0.0119
Problem:No test for using CTRL-R on the command line.
Solution: Add a test. (Dominique Pelle) And some more.
Files: src/testdir/test_cmdline.vim
*** ../vim-8.0.0118/src/testdir/test_cmdline.vim2016-10-15
15:39:34.689059624 +0200
---
Dominique Pellé wrote:
> Pasting in command line with CTRL-R is currently
> not tested according to coveralls:
>
> https://coveralls.io/builds/9083549/source?filename=src%2Fex_getln.c#L3181
>
> Attached patch adds a test for it. It should exercise at
> least those functions which are entirely
Patch 8.0.0120
Problem:Channel test is still flaky on OS X.
Solution: Set the drop argument to "never".
Files: src/testdir/test_channel.vim
*** ../vim-8.0.0119/src/testdir/test_channel.vim2016-12-01
16:41:47.296864891 +0100
--- src/testdir/test_channel.vim2016-12-03